The Basics of Electric Axles
An electric axle, also known as an e - axle, is an integrated system that combines an electric motor, a transmission, and an axle into a single unit. This design simplifies the drivetrain of a vehicle, reducing the number of components and the overall weight. For trucks, this means more space for cargo and potentially lower energy consumption.

Advantages of Electric Axles in Long - Haul Trucks
-
Energy Efficiency
One of the most significant advantages of electric axles in long - haul trucks is energy efficiency. Traditional internal combustion engines lose a significant amount of energy through heat dissipation and mechanical friction. In contrast, electric axles can convert a higher percentage of electrical energy into mechanical energy, resulting in less energy waste. This efficiency is particularly important for long - haul operations, where fuel costs can be a major expense. -
Reduced Maintenance
Electric axles have fewer moving parts compared to traditional drivetrains. With no engine oil changes, fewer gears, and less complex cooling systems, the maintenance requirements are significantly reduced. This is a major benefit for long - haul trucking companies, as it means less downtime and lower maintenance costs over the life of the vehicle. -
Environmental Benefits
Long - haul trucks are significant contributors to greenhouse gas emissions. By using electric axles, these trucks can operate with zero tailpipe emissions. This not only helps to reduce the carbon footprint of the transportation industry but also complies with increasingly strict environmental regulations in many regions. -
Regenerative Braking
Electric axles can utilize regenerative braking technology. When the truck brakes, the electric motor acts as a generator, converting the kinetic energy of the vehicle into electrical energy and storing it in the battery. This energy can then be used to power the vehicle later, extending the driving range. For long - haul trucks that often need to brake on downhill sections or in traffic, regenerative braking can significantly improve energy efficiency.
Challenges of Using Electric Axles in Long - Haul Trucks
- Range Anxiety
One of the biggest challenges for long - haul trucks with electric axles is range anxiety. Unlike traditional diesel trucks that can refuel quickly and travel long distances without interruption, electric trucks need to recharge their batteries. The current charging infrastructure for heavy - duty vehicles is still limited, and charging times can be long. This means that long - haul truck drivers may worry about running out of power before reaching their destination or having to spend too much time waiting for a charge. - Battery Weight and Cost
The batteries required to power electric axles in long - haul trucks are large and heavy. This added weight reduces the payload capacity of the truck, which can be a significant drawback for trucking companies. Additionally, the cost of high - capacity batteries is still relatively high, increasing the upfront cost of electric trucks compared to their diesel counterparts. - Power Requirements
Long - haul trucks often need to operate in a variety of conditions, including high - speed highway driving, climbing steep grades, and carrying heavy loads. Meeting these power requirements with an electric axle can be challenging. The electric motor and battery system need to be designed to provide sufficient power while still maintaining energy efficiency.
Solutions to the Challenges
- Improved Battery Technology
The development of advanced battery technologies is crucial for the widespread adoption of electric axles in long - haul trucks. New battery chemistries, such as solid - state batteries, promise higher energy density, faster charging times, and longer lifespans. These improvements would help to reduce range anxiety, decrease battery weight, and lower the overall cost of electric trucks. - Expansion of Charging Infrastructure
To address the issue of range anxiety, there needs to be a significant expansion of the charging infrastructure for heavy - duty vehicles. Governments and private companies are increasingly investing in the development of fast - charging stations along major highways. These stations would allow long - haul trucks to recharge quickly and continue their journeys with minimal disruption. - Hybrid Solutions
Another approach to overcoming the challenges of using electric axles in long - haul trucks is to use hybrid solutions. A hybrid truck combines an electric axle with a traditional internal combustion engine or a range - extender generator. This allows the truck to operate on electric power for short distances or in urban areas, while the combustion engine or generator can provide additional power for long - haul trips.
